Kopke unveils 80-year-old tawny

Published:  12 November, 2025

Port house Kopke has unveiled its first ever 80-Year-Old Tawny. The 1638-founded producer follows Graham’s and Taylor’s, who both introduced the category to their respective ranges this year.

Port: Weathering the Covid storm

Published:  24 November, 2020

The UK remains at the forefront of the premium Port category, with sales of late-bottled vintage (LBV), quality white Port, aged tawnies, single vineyard and classic vintage ports, all remaining resilient through Covid. A nation of consumers stuck at home, looking to indulge, appears to have been largely positive for the quality end of UK Port sales. Built on a long-standing relationship with the UK, sales at Symington Family Estates are up 10% by value and 9% by volume compared with this time last year.
